Abstract
This paper presents researches related to assimilate and coapt object-oriented paradigm to hardware design and hardware systems management. Considered systems are consist of reprogrammable hardware chips (FPGA). Classification of depicted approaches is proposed and discussed. At the end the paper introduces novel model for visualization, design, implementation and management of complex, highly adaptive hardware systems. Novel model of software framework managing such a modeled systems is described.
